How Erskine Mayer's Sacrifice Hit Compares to Similar Players
Erskine Mayer totaled 20 career Sacrifice Hit, well below the league average of 27.0 — production that significantly underperformed against league baselines. His best Sacrifice Hit season came in 1915, posting 5, well below the league average of 7.8 that year. The lowest point came in 1912 at 0, well below the league average of 6.7 that year. Production slipped through the final seasons. The Sacrifice Hit total went from 5 in 1917 to 4 in 1918 and 1 in 1919, falling over the span. The decline marked the closing chapter of the career. Significant season-to-season variance characterizes the Sacrifice Hit profile — ranging from 0 to 5 — though the career average remained well below league norms.
